What if I was partly at fault for the motorcycle accident?Nevada uses a modified comparative negligence standard. Provided your share of fault does not exceed the majority, you can still recover compensation reduced by your percentage of fault. Insurance companies often try to inflate your share of fault, and a skilled motorcycle accident lawyer pushes back aggressively.

How long do I have to take legal action after a motorcycle crash?You generally have a two-year window from the crash date to initiate legal action. Failing to file within the time limit can permanently bar your claim. Specific circumstances may alter the timeline, which is why waiting to get help is never a good idea.
